LBC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review
57 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Luther Burbank Corporation Common Stock (LBC)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$145M — up 9% from $133M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 10 funds closed out of LBC and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 6 trimmed existing stakes and 34 added.
The largest buyer was Basswood Capital Management, adding an estimated $5.84M. The largest seller was Jennison Associates, exiting entirely with an estimated $6.4M sold.
